Medical Image Management Market size was valued at USD 4.01 Billion in 2024 and is poised to grow from USD 4.32 Billion in 2025 to USD 7.76 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 7.6% during the forecast period (2026-2033).
Medical image management encompasses the systematic handling of medical images through integrated platforms, facilitating early disease detection and effective treatment strategies. Utilizing high-quality imaging is pivotal for advancing diagnostics in healthcare. This process involves careful documentation and archiving of findings, ensuring medical professionals can devise precise treatment plans. Key components of imaging science include segmentation, registration, and visualization, alongside data manipulation and assessment. The rise of big data in healthcare significantly enhances these systems, enabling secure storage and in-depth analysis of extensive datasets. With the ongoing integration of data analytics and artificial intelligence, medical image management is poised for substantial growth, empowering healthcare providers to leverage patient histories for improved outcomes and timely interventions.

Medical Image Management Market Segments Analysis
Global Medical Image Management Market is segmented by Product, End User and region. Based on Product, the market is segmented into picture archiving and communication systems (PACS), vendor neutral archives (VNA) and application-independent clinical archives (AICA). Based on End User, the market is segmented into hospitals, diagnostic imaging centers and other end users (ambulatory surgical centers, small clinics, and contract research organizations). Based on region, the market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America and Middle East & Africa.
Driver of the Medical Image Management Market
The global medical image management market is being significantly influenced by several key factors. Increased investment from both public and private sectors, along with a rise in the number of diagnostic imaging centers, plays a crucial role in market expansion. Additionally, the growing prevalence of cancer, coupled with an ageing population that experiences a higher incidence of various diseases, further fuels this growth. Technological advancements in diagnostic imaging are also contributing to the market's development, en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of medical imaging solutions. Together, these elements create a robust environment for the medical image management market to thrive.
Restraints in the Medical Image Management Market
The Medical Image Management market faces significant challenges due to increasing budgetary constraints and the extended shelf life of Vendor Neutral Archives (VNAs), which hinder growth. Additionally, the growing dependence on capital equipment purchases linked to both VNA and PACS sales raises further obstacles. Compounding these issues are usability and user interface concerns that can impact user adoption and satisfaction. As these factors continue to evolve, they are likely to create substantial barriers to market expansion, affecting both the development and implementation of medical image management solutions and ultimately limiting their widespread integration within healthcare systems.
Market Trends of the Medical Image Management Market
The Medical Image Management market is experiencing a significant upward trend, fueled by the rising incidence of chronic illnesses that necessitate enhanced clinical imaging diagnostics. The demand for advanced Picture Archiving and Communication Systems (PACS) is being bolstered by the adoption of hybrid cloud models, which prioritize data security through offshore and local storage solutions, ensuring continuous access to imaging data. Additionally, the integration of innovative technologies like art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) into PACS interfaces is driving productivity improvements for medical staff. This combination of factors positions the market for robust growth in the evolving healthcare landscape.
